Temoe, or Te Moe, is a small atoll of the Gambier Islands in French Polynesia. It is located in the far southeast of the Tuamotu group archipelago. Temoe Atoll is trapezoidal in shape and bound by a continuous reef with many small shallow spillways. Its islands are low and flat and the lagoon has no navigable pass to enter it. Temoe is permanently uninhabited. Administratively it belongs to the commune of the Gambier Islands.
